>> Does any one have a suggestion with regard to finding a piano
>> mover to move a machine from Oklahoma to Massachusetts?


Dear Shay (and list),  There are several cross country piano movers
that I know of, but I have not used any of them personally.

Modern Piano Moving moves pianos door to door

Keyboard Carriage moves pianos only from loading dock to loading dock,
and usually only for dealers or piano manufacturers.

I recently had a call from a lady in Chicago wanting to move a small
grand piano from Neosho, Missouri, to Chicago, and she was quoted a
price of around $1000.00 by an unknown mover and was looking for a less
expensive option.  Unfortunately, it seems to cost an arm and a leg to
move pianos cross-country these days.  If you have a good experience
